School Notes
- We are committed to building mature minds, compassionate hearts and individual integrity through quality instruction, work and practice.
- Mature mindspractice critical thinking, take responsibility, love to learn, and embrace the discovery of individual learning styles.
- Compassionatehearts practice relationships built on caring, respect, and encouragement. They reach out at school, home and in the community.
- Integritydemonstrates the pursuit and realization of God's character and strives to reflect this in daily life.

Frequently Asked Questions
How much does Forest Park Adventist Christian School cost?
Forest Park Adventist Christian School's tuition is approximately $5,000 for private students.
What is Forest Park Adventist Christian School's ranking?
Forest Park Adventist Christian School ranks among the top 20% of private schools in Washington for: Least expensive tuition, Highest percentage of students of color and Oldest founding date.
When is the application deadline for Forest Park Adventist Christian School?
The application deadline for Forest Park Adventist Christian School is rolling (applications are reviewed as they are received year-round).
In what neighborhood is Forest Park Adventist Christian School located?
Forest Park Adventist Christian School is located in the Port Gardner neighborhood of Everett, WA.
